Brazilian apple production is rebounding.
2026-02-18 08:00
Brazil is expecting a higher and healthier apple harvest for 2025/26, with production estimated to range between 1.05 million and 1.15 million tonnes, as reported by the Brazilian Apple Producers Association (ABPM). The association stated that favorable climatic conditions have resulted in a crop of high quality, with excellent coloration.

The South African apple and pear season has started earlier than usual, presenting both opportunities and uncertainties for producers. Early reports suggest good fruit quality, but factors like hail damage, water availability, logistics, and exchange-rate volatility are expected to influence the season.

According to Chiranjeevi A R, CEO of Scion Agricos, India's apple importers are now more interested in sourcing apples from European countries like Poland and Italy. This shift is driven by the weather challenges and low market sentiment affecting traditional suppliers this season. Educating shoppers is the solution for Australian apples.
2026-02-17 00:00
Victorian grower Mark Trzaskoma believes that Australia's apple industry can grow without needing to look overseas, despite the challenges that come with that option. He suggests that improving communication with consumers is key. Trzaskoma, who is the Production Manager at Battunga Orchards in Warragul, argues that the local market still has untapped potential.
